On 2026-08-13, before the release, RAOSCAFF locked a binary: Alibaba's cloud external revenue would grow at least 30% year on year in the June quarter. It grew 45%. P-139 is a HIT — and this brief discloses the complication: Alibaba renamed the reporting segment between our lock and the print.
For the quarter ended 30 June 2026, Alibaba reported AI Cloud and Compute Services revenue of RMB48,437m (US$7,139m), with year-over-year growth of total revenue AND revenue from external customers both accelerating to 45%. Group revenue rose 9% to RMB269bn. Source: Alibaba Group June-quarter 2026 results, 20 August 2026.
We locked a binary at 85% confidence: Alibaba's cloud external revenue would grow at least 30% year on year in the June quarter. The floor was set well below the 40% external growth the company had reported for the March quarter, on the reasoning that AI-driven public cloud demand was structural rather than a single-quarter spike. External revenue growth accelerated to 45%. P-139 resolves as a HIT.

Our criterion named Cloud Intelligence external revenue. Between the lock and the print, Alibaba restructured its reporting: the segment is now AI Cloud and Compute Services, and it folds in the company's T-Head chip arm. A composition change like that can quietly invalidate a locked criterion, so we do not pass over it. Three things make the verdict robust. The renamed segment is the direct successor to the one we locked. The company reported that external-customer revenue growth specifically — not just total segment revenue — accelerated to 45%. And the pre-rename figure was already 40% in the March quarter, comfortably above our 30% floor, so the call clears with or without the added business. We also flag a live trap for anyone checking this: a widely-syndicated headline reporting Cloud Intelligence revenue up 6% refers to the quarter ended June 2024, not this one.
